Output c8435b8acb2de4acb4dcb19f50a1d06037a8f25d6424fc5d17fb676865363c32:1

value
21309458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56baeb81de028dded0092ea775e2ec83006792d0 OP_EQUALVERIFY OP_CHECKSIG
address
18ub2vYpdSJTd91AeUnCwqFHn9KK1bHMpj
transaction
c8435b8acb2de4acb4dcb19f50a1d06037a8f25d6424fc5d17fb676865363c32
spent
true